Landscape and trails
Ząbkowice County lies between the Bardo, Sowie and Złote mountain ranges and the Niemczańsko-Strzelińskie Hills; the Nysa Kłodzka flows through it.

History and culture
The county seat, ZÄ…bkowice ÅšlÄ…skie, was founded in Silesia in the late 13th century by German settlers during the rule of Henry IV Probus as Frankenstein. Henryków, the Cistercian monastery and the Book of Henryków are cultural and historical references within the broader visitor context of Ząbkowice County.
The cultural and historical visitor context of Ząbkowice County also includes Srebrna Góra Fortress, described as a significant military-historical complex, and the 19th-century neo-Gothic Marianna Orańska Palace in Kamieniec Ząbkowicki.
